  • First there are a lot of errors more than likely causing the problem. https://validator.w3.org/check?verbose=1&uri=http%3a%2f%2fjohn-edwards-blog.com%2f

    Next try:

    – deactivating all plugins to see if this resolves the problem. If this works, re-activate the plugins one by one until you find the problematic plugin(s).

    – switching to the Twenty Ten theme to rule out any theme-specific problems.

    – resetting the plugins folder by FTP or PhpMyAdmin. Sometimes, an apparently inactive plugin can still cause problems.
